Aprendiendo Python: ¿Es difícil de aprender?

¿Es difícil aprender Python?

Python es un lenguaje de programación de alto nivel, de código abierto y muy popular, que se utiliza en una variedad de aplicaciones. Python se ha convertido en uno de los lenguajes de programación más utilizados en el mundo, gracias a su simplicidad y versatilidad. Aunque hay muchas personas que afirman que Python es un lenguaje fácil de aprender, hay otros que se preguntan si realmente es así.

En este artículo discutiremos si Python es un lenguaje difícil de aprender o no. Para ayudar a responder esta pregunta, examinaremos los pros y los contras de aprender Python, así como los factores que pueden influir en el aprendizaje.

Ventajas de aprender Python

Python es un lenguaje de programación fácil de aprender. Esto se debe a que su sintaxis es muy intuitiva y clara, lo que significa que los programadores novatos no tienen que lidiar con conceptos complejos de programación. Además, hay una gran cantidad de recursos de aprendizaje en línea disponibles para ayudar a los principiantes a comprender los conceptos básicos de Python. Estos recursos incluyen tutoriales, libros electrónicos, vídeos y foros en línea.

Otra ventaja de aprender Python es que hay una gran cantidad de herramientas y bibliotecas disponibles para ayudar a los programadores a desarrollar sus aplicaciones. Estas herramientas y bibliotecas hacen que sea más fácil escribir código y permiten a los programadores ahorrar tiempo y esfuerzo.

  Cómo utilizar los métodos GET y POST para administrar ingresos y gastos en una aplicación

Desventajas de aprender Python

Aunque Python es un lenguaje fácil de aprender, hay algunos aspectos que lo hacen difícil de aprender. En primer lugar, Python es un lenguaje interpretado, lo que significa que los errores de sintaxis se detectan en tiempo de ejecución. Esto significa que los errores de sintaxis no se detectan hasta que el programa se está ejecutando, lo que puede ser frustrante para los principiantes.

Además, a diferencia de otros lenguajes de programación, como Java y C++, Python no tiene una sintaxis estricta. Esto significa que los programadores no necesitan seguir reglas estrictas para escribir código, lo que significa que los principiantes pueden escribir código que no es correcto o no es óptimo. Esto puede ser desalentador para los principiantes que quieren aprender el lenguaje de la manera correcta.

Factores que influyen en la facilidad de aprender Python

Además de los pros y los contras de aprender Python, hay algunos factores que pueden influir en la facilidad de aprender el lenguaje. Estos factores incluyen la motivación, la habilidad para comprender la sintaxis, el tiempo dedicado al estudio, la disponibilidad de recursos de aprendizaje y la capacidad de usar el lenguaje en la práctica.

Motivación

Un factor importante en la facilidad de aprender Python es la motivación. Si los principiantes están motivados para aprender el lenguaje, entonces tendrán más probabilidades de éxito. Por otro lado, si los principiantes no están motivados para aprender, entonces es probable que encuentren el lenguaje difícil de aprender.

Comprensión de la sintaxis

Otro factor importante en la facilidad de aprender Python es la habilidad para comprender la sintaxis. Aunque Python es un lenguaje de programación intuitivo, los principiantes aún necesitan comprender cómo funciona el lenguaje antes de poder usarlo para desarrollar aplicaciones. Esto significa que los principiantes deben dedicar tiempo a la comprensión de los conceptos básicos antes de poder avanzar.

  Cinco consejos para mejorar la productividad en el desarrollo de programas

Tiempo dedicado al estudio

Además, el tiempo dedicado al estudio es un factor importante en la facilidad de aprender Python. Si los principiantes dedican suficiente tiempo al estudio y al aprendizaje, entonces tendrán una mejor comprensión de los conceptos y tendrán más probabilidades de éxito.

Recursos de aprendizaje

La disponibilidad de recursos de aprendizaje es otro factor importante en la facilidad de aprender Python. Si los principiantes tienen acceso a tutoriales, libros electrónicos, vídeos y foros en línea, entonces tendrán una mejor comprensión de los conceptos y tendrán más probabilidades de éxito.

Uso en la práctica

Finalmente, la capacidad de usar el lenguaje en la práctica es un factor importante en la facilidad de aprender Python. Si los principiantes tienen la oportunidad de poner en práctica los conceptos que han aprendido, entonces tendrán una mejor comprensión de los conceptos y tendrán más probabilidades de éxito.

Conclusión

En conclusión, Python es un lenguaje de programación intuitivo y fácil de aprender. Aunque hay algunos aspectos que lo hacen un poco difícil de aprender, hay una serie de factores que influyen en la facilidad de aprender Python, como la motivación, la habilidad para comprender la sintaxis, el tiempo dedicado al estudio, la disponibilidad de recursos de aprendizaje y la capacidad de usar el lenguaje en la práctica. Si los principiantes tienen estos factores, entonces tendrán más probabilidades de éxito.

  Cómo crear un entorno virtual: Una guía paso a paso
Esta web utiliza cookies propias y de terceros para su correcto funcionamiento y para fines analíticos y para mostrarte publicidad relacionada con sus preferencias en base a un perfil elaborado a partir de tus hábitos de navegación. Al hacer clic en el botón Aceptar, acepta el uso de estas tecnologías y el procesamiento de tus datos para estos propósitos. Más información
Privacidad